The students who entered this year’s competition were predominately from the Amissville area and ranged in age from 9 to 16 years old. Their performances included both voice (alto and mezzo-soprano) and instruments (including trombone, piano, saxophone, French horn, and trumpet).
Musical numbers included classical and contemporary as well as religious. “Wild Honeysuckle Rag” played on the piano by Caroline Massey was applauded fortissimo along with classical pieces like Dvorak’s “New World Symphony” played on the French horn by Sarah Wheatley.
